NEWS RELEASE FOR ICOMES 2000 & ICME 2000

 

TO ALL ICOMES MEMBER SOCIETIES:

Thanks to the support from all member societies, the preparation of ICOMES 2000 and ICME 2000 is progressing smoothly. By the end of May 2000, CMES has received 1,936 papers from 29 countries and regions.

ENTREPRENEURS FORUM & ICME PLENARY SESSION

For the benefit of further fruitful cooperation between the learned societies and the industrial communities, CMES shall organize an entrepreneur’s forum during ICOMES 2000 as well as a plenary session during ICME 2000. VENUE

In order to provide the best conference facilities in Shanghai, CMES has decided to hold all events of ICOMES and ICME at Shanghai International Convention Center.

Shanghai International Convention Center is conveniently situated in the heart of Pudong Development Zone, Shanghai’s future-place to be. Along the riverside boulevard and overlooking the legendary Bund while only 25 and 30 minutes’ drive to Hongqian International Airport and Pudong International Airport respectively, Shanghai International Convention Center enjoys an ideal geographic location surrounded by a rich transportation network of three-dimension.

As the conference venue hosted the Fortune Global Forum 1999, not only does Shanghai International Convention Center offers a choice of 22 meeting rooms with seating capacity ranging from 50 up to 1000, exhibition facilities of the center also ranks high within Shanghai. What’s more, the pillarless Grand Ball Room of the center, one of the highest in China, is able to hold 4000 people, either for banquet of conference. Most importantly, all of these are backed up by a full range of most advanced audio/visual equipment and supervised by a team of professional meeting service experts.
